ExcelとAccessの連携でデータ分析を効率化する方法

# ExcelとAccessの連携でデータ分析を効率化する方法
この記事では、ExcelとAccessを連携させることで、データ分析を効率化する方法について解説します。データ分析は、ビジネスにおける意思決定に欠かせないツールであり、ExcelとAccessはそのための強力なソフトウェアです。両者の強みを活かしたデータ分析を実現することで、より深い分析や可視化が可能になります。
ExcelとAccessを連携させることで、データ管理の効率化、データ分析の効率化、データの整合性、データ共有の容易さなどが実現できます。Excelの豊富なグラフ機能や分析機能と、Accessのデータベース機能を組み合わせることで、データ分析の精度とスピードが向上します。さらに、両者の連携により、データの自動化や可視化も可能になります。
この記事では、ExcelとAccessの連携方法について詳しく解説します。具体的には、ODBC接続、VBA、データのインポート/エクスポートなどについて説明します。これらの方法を活用することで、データ分析を効率化し、ビジネスにおける意思決定を支援することができます。
ExcelとAccessの連携のメリット
ExcelとAccessを連携させることで、データ分析を効率化することができます。# データ分析の効率化は、ビジネス上の意思決定に役立つ重要な要素です。ExcelとAccessを組み合わせることで、データの管理、分析、可視化が容易になります。
Excelの豊富なグラフ機能や分析機能は、データの可視化と分析に役立ちます。一方、Accessのデータベース機能は、大量のデータを管理し、データの整合性を保つことができます。両者の強みを活かしたデータ分析を実現することで、より深い分析や可視化が可能になります。
また、ExcelとAccessの連携により、データ管理の効率化も実現できます。データのインポート/エクスポートが容易になり、データの共有も簡単になります。これにより、チームメンバー間でのデータの共有や、データの更新が容易になります。データの整合性も保たれるため、データの信頼性が高まります。
ExcelとAccessの連携方法
ExcelとAccessを連携させることで、データ分析を効率化する方法について解説します。両者の強みを活かしたデータ分析を実現できます。具体的には、Excelの豊富なグラフ機能や分析機能と、Accessのデータベース機能を組み合わせることで、より深い分析や可視化が可能になります。
# ExcelとAccessの連携方法としては、ODBC接続が挙げられます。ODBC接続を使用することで、Accessのデータベースに接続し、Excelでデータを分析することができます。ODBC接続は、AccessのデータベースをExcelで直接操作できるようにするため、データのインポート/エクスポートが不要になります。
また、VBAを使用することで、ExcelとAccessの連携を自動化することができます。VBAを使用することで、データのインポート/エクスポートやデータの加工などを自動化することができます。これにより、データ分析の効率化が実現できます。データの整合性やデータ共有の容易さも向上します。
データのインポート/エクスポートも、ExcelとAccessの連携方法として挙げられます。データのインポート/エクスポートを使用することで、AccessのデータベースからExcelにデータを転送することができます。データのインポート/エクスポートは、データの更新やデータの加工などに使用することができます。
ODBC接続による連携
ODBC接続を使用することで、ExcelとAccessの連携が可能になります。ODBC(Open Database Connectivity)とは、データベースに接続するための標準的なインターフェイスです。ExcelからAccessのデータベースに接続することで、AccessのデータをExcelで分析することができます。
この方法の利点は、Accessのデータベースを直接操作することなく、Excelでデータ分析が可能になることです。また、データの更新も自動的に反映されるため、データの整合性を維持することができます。ただし、ODBC接続にはいくつかの制限があります。たとえば、データの更新は一方向のみであり、Accessのデータベースに直接更新することはできません。
また、ODBC接続にはセキュリティ上の考慮も必要です。データベースへの接続には認証が必要であり、不正アクセスを防ぐために適切な設定が必要です。にもかかわらず、ODBC接続はExcelとAccessの連携を実現するための便利な方法であり、データ分析の効率化に役立ちます。
VBAによる連携
VBAを使用することで、ExcelとAccessの連携を実現できます。VBAは、Visual Basic for Applicationsの略で、Microsoft Officeアプリケーションに搭載されているプログラミング言語です。VBAを使用することで、ExcelとAccessのデータを相互に操作することができます。
たとえば、ExcelのデータをAccessのデータベースにインポートしたり、AccessのデータをExcelのシートにエクスポートしたりすることができます。また、VBAを使用することで、データの加工や分析も自動化することができます。例えば、ExcelのデータをAccessのデータベースにインポートし、Accessのクエリを使用してデータを分析した後、結果をExcelのシートにエクスポートすることができます。
このように、VBAを使用することで、ExcelとAccessの連携を実現し、データ分析を効率化することができます。ただし、VBAのプログラミングには一定の知識とスキルが必要です。
データのインポート/エクスポートによる連携
データのインポート/エクスポートによる連携は、ExcelとAccessのデータを相互にやり取りするための基本的な方法です。ExcelのデータをAccessにインポートすることで、Accessのデータベース機能を活用してデータを管理・分析することができます。逆に、AccessのデータをExcelにエクスポートすることで、Excelの豊富なグラフ機能や分析機能を活用してデータを可視化・分析することができます。
この方法は、データの量が少ない場合や、データの構造が単純な場合に有効です。ただし、データの量が多くなったり、データの構造が複雑になったりすると、インポート/エクスポートの作業が煩雑になる可能性があります。そのため、データの量や構造に応じて、他の連携方法を検討する必要があります。
また、データのインポート/エクスポートによる連携では、データの整合性を確保することが重要です。データのインポート/エクスポートの際に、データの形式や構造が変わらないように注意する必要があります。データの整合性を確保することで、データ分析の結果が正確で信頼できるものになることができます。
データ分析の効率化例
データ分析の効率化は、ExcelとAccessの連携によって実現できます。Excelの豊富なグラフ機能や分析機能を活用することで、データの傾向や特徴をより明確に把握することができます。一方、Accessのデータベース機能を利用することで、大量のデータを効率的に管理・分析することが可能になります。
# データ管理の効率化 を実現するためには、Accessのデータベース機能を活用することが重要です。Accessでは、データをテーブルに整理し、データの追加・更新・削除を容易に行うことができます。また、データの検索やフィルタリングも簡単に行うことができます。これにより、データの管理が大幅に効率化され、データ分析に必要な時間が短縮されます。
ExcelとAccessの連携によって、データ分析の効率化が実現します。Excelの分析機能を活用することで、データの傾向や特徴をより明確に把握することができます。また、Accessのデータベース機能を利用することで、大量のデータを効率的に管理・分析することが可能になります。これにより、データ分析の精度が向上し、より的確な意思決定が可能になります。
まとめ
ExcelとAccessを連携させることで、データ分析を効率化する方法について解説しました。両者の強みを活かしたデータ分析を実現することで、データ管理の効率化、データ分析の効率化、データの整合性、データ共有の容易さなどが実現できます。
データ分析の効率化を実現するためには、Excelの豊富なグラフ機能や分析機能と、Accessのデータベース機能を組み合わせることが重要です。具体的には、Accessでデータを管理し、Excelでデータを分析することで、より深い分析や可視化が可能になります。
また、連携方法としては、ODBC接続、VBA、データのインポート/エクスポートなどがあります。これらの方法を活用することで、データ分析を効率化し、より深い分析や可視化が可能になります。
# を使用して、データを管理し、分析することで、データ分析の効率化を実現することができます。データ分析の効率化を実現することで、ビジネス上の意思決定に役立つ情報を提供することができます。
まとめ
ExcelとAccessを連携させることで、データ分析を効率化する方法について解説しました。両者の強みを活かしたデータ分析を実現することで、データ管理の効率化、データ分析の効率化、データの整合性、データ共有の容易さなどが実現できます。
よくある質問
ExcelとAccessの連携でデータ分析を効率化する方法とは何か
ExcelとAccessの連携は、データ分析の効率化を実現するための方法です。Excelは、表計算ソフトウェアとして広く利用されており、データの集計や分析に適しています。一方、Accessは、データベース管理システムとして、大量のデータを管理するのに適しています。両者を連携させることで、データの収集、管理、分析を一元化し、データ分析の効率を大幅に向上させることができます。
ExcelとAccessの連携に必要なソフトウェアやツールは何か
ExcelとAccessの連携には、Microsoft OfficeのExcelとAccessが必要です。また、ODBC (Open Database Connectivity) ドライバーを使用して、Accessのデータベースに接続する必要があります。さらに、VBA (Visual Basic for Applications) を使用して、ExcelとAccessの間でデータを転送するマクロを作成することもできます。
ExcelとAccessの連携でデータ分析を効率化するためのベストプラクティスは何か
ExcelとAccessの連携でデータ分析を効率化するためのベストプラクティスとしては、データの正規化が重要です。データを正規化することで、データの重複を排除し、データの整合性を保つことができます。また、データのバックアップも重要です。データを定期的にバックアップすることで、データの喪失を防ぐことができます。
ExcelとAccessの連携でデータ分析を効率化するためのトラブルシューティング方法は何か
ExcelとAccessの連携でデータ分析を効率化するためのトラブルシューティング方法としては、エラーメッセージの確認が重要です。エラーメッセージを確認することで、エラーの原因を特定し、解決策を講じることができます。また、データの確認も重要です。データを確認することで、データの不正を特定し、修正することができます。
コメントを残す
コメントを投稿するにはログインしてください。

関連ブログ記事